Andi's point about "don't do that if it hurts" is well taken, but Lantz (the original poster) has no bulk transfer option, and doesn't want to wait the extra 20 ms per transfer for no good reason. I've modified the patch so that at least the optimization doesn't hurt us for small transfers as it does now.
In a stock 2.2.1 kernel, the receiving end of the 723-byte transfer is in quickack mode, and has ato = 1 when the data comes in. Then tcp_remember_ack() tries to "help" us by noticing the PSH flag and the small transfer size, so it kills quickack and sets ato = 2. Questionable.
I try to curb that behavior while still allowing the original optimization intended by the routine, in the following patch.

This is a bit more complex, but only affects the one little corner case of single (web-like) transfers in the range 1--723 bytes (on ether), where ato is still smaller than HZ/50. For reference, here's my earlier suggestion which DaveM conceptually approved, and I still favor for its simplicity.

Dave, I'd like to see the latter patch in the kernel. Both attempt to preserve quickack mode, but the former patch does extra work to ensure it only does so if ato is already quite small (< 20 ms). Both will return with ato <= HZ/50, but the former works hard not to raise the ato. Intuitively I don't see the case happening, so think the latter is sufficient.
